It seems like Apple iPad Fold, boasting an 18.8” display, is likely to miss the 2026 deadline. Apparently, it might be tossed around to 2028 based on the various estimates that we have so far. It kind of puts Apple in a seemingly disappointing position, given the fact that various Android smartphone makers have already been in several generations of foldable phones.

Apple iPad Fold launch is disputed, again!

There have been reports around Apple’s iPhone Fold and iPad Fold for ages. While the iPhone Fold might arrive, there have been several reports suggesting that the iPad Fold could arrive in 2026 or 2028. Both estimates are poles apart, and yet, it seems Apple might miss the 2026 production deadline.

Earlier, it wasn’t clear if Apple was talking about a foldable iPad or a MacBook, given the ginormous 18.8” foldable panel at the helm. Seems like reports there’s a heavy inclination towards Apple iPad Fold with a similar 18.8” display. This was further substantiated when Apple analyst Ming-Chi Kuo found a large foldable display in the supply chain.

According to the folks at MacRumors, both iPad Fold and iPhone 18 Fold (or just iPhone Fold) were expected to launch in late 2026. However, latest reports suggest a delay in production on the larger display, pushing the launch schedule of the iPad Fold. Jeff Pu, a lead analyst at an investment firm — GF Securities, says that the 18.8-inch” foldable iPad device has likely been postponed, although he didn’t back it up with the reason behind the delay. 

Mark Gurman of Bloomberg further adds that the foldable iPad would come around 2028, while Ross Young says it could make it in 2026 or 2027. Although we further mentioned how the Cupertino-based giant might have missed 2026 plans, it is still coming from unofficial sources and not directly from Apple.

This begs the question whether Apple will launch its foldable iPhone and iPad devices soon enough, and if so, whether it will have the same charismatic effect that the original iPhone had when it arrived in 2008.
